The Opportunity

When you join PwC Acceleration Centers (ACs), you step into a pivotal role focused on actively supporting various Acceleration Center services, from Advisory to Assurance, Tax and Business Services. In our innovative hubs, you’ll engage in challenging projects and provide distinctive services to support client engagements through enhanced quality and innovation. You’ll also participate in dynamic and digitally enabled training that is designed to grow your technical and professional skills.

As part of the Facilities and Infrastructure Management team you lead the oversight of planning, construction, and maintenance of office sites to meet worker needs. As a Manager, you are accountable for driving infrastructure expansion, managing team performance, and fostering collaboration across units to address challenges effectively.

Responsibilities

  • Oversee facilities and infrastructure management projects
  • Supervise teams to achieve successful project execution
  • Mentor staff to develop their skills and knowledge
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to align project objectives
  • Analyze operational processes to identify areas for enhancement
  • Foster a culture of continuous learning and development
  • Manage project timelines and deliverables effectively
  • Lead initiatives that enhance operational effectiveness

What You Must Have

  • Bachelors Degree
  • 5 years of experience in Facilities Management
  • Oral and written proficiency in English required
  • Certification in safety management preferred such as BOSH, LCM & HIRAC

What Sets You Apart

  • Preferred Degree in Engineering
  • Certification in safety management
  • Skilled in safety and security standards
  • Background in facilities maintenance
  • Excelling in written and verbal communication
  • Competence in MS Office applications
  • Demonstrating project management skills
  • Knowledgeable in PEZA and BOI regulations
  • Understanding of customer service
